Our Scientists Emeriti
In the combined 100-year history of the two organizations that came together to establish the Alliance of Bioversity International and CIAT, our science was supported by many researchers, who dedicated their lives to transforming food systems. Those who demonstrated exceptional contributions to the Alliance's mission are recognized as Scientists Emeriti: they are people who acted as ambassadors for the Alliance, accelerated resource mobilization, mentored staff and students, advised on the Alliance strategy, and, principally, made exceptional contributions to the Alliance's research.
